Small towns in Kansas struggle with local economy

 

February 18, 2018



HUTCHINSON, Kan. (AP) — Small towns in Kansas are trying to revitalize a struggling local economy amid challenges to attract businesses to the area.

A Kansas Department of Commerce report said that just three of the state's successful business recruitment projects were outside of the Kansas City metro areas last fiscal year. The report said those three projects represented 10 percent of total business investment but only accounted for 0.25 percent of the new jobs.
